20 Questions to Ask Before Trusting Any Germany Nursing Placement Agency

Indian nurse sitting confidently across a desk from a recruitment counsellor, holding a notepad with questions written on it
๐ŸŽฏ You are about to make one of the most important financial and life decisions you will ever make. Before trusting any agency with your future, ask these 20 questions. A legitimate agency answers every single one clearly. A fraudulent agency will not.

The Germany nursing opportunity has attracted hundreds of placement agencies across India โ€” ranging from genuinely excellent organisations to outright fraud. The challenge is that from the outside, they can look almost identical. Both have WhatsApp groups, Instagram pages, YouTube testimonials, and polished websites.

The difference shows up when you ask the right questions. Here are the 20 questions every nurse should ask before trusting any agency โ€” and what the right answer looks like for each.

Questions About Legitimacy

1 Are you licensed by the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A)?

This is non-negotiable. Every legitimate overseas recruitment agency operating in India must hold a valid MEA Registration Certificate. Ask for the registration number and verify it yourself at mea.gov.in. If they cannot provide this or give you excuses, stop the conversation.

2 Can I see your MEA certificate?

Not just the number โ€” ask to see the physical certificate. A legitimate agency will produce it without hesitation. Note the name of the registered company, the registration number, and the validity date. Verify it online.

3 What is your company's registered legal name and address?

The MEA licence is issued to a specific legal entity. The agency's trading name may differ from the registered legal name. Verify that the address is real โ€” you should be able to visit it.

Questions About Their Track Record

4 How many nurses have you placed in Germany or Austria so far?

Ask for a specific number โ€” not a vague "many" or "hundreds." A legitimate organisation knows its placement count. Ask follow-up questions: in which hospitals? In which states? How recently?

5 Can you give me contact details for two nurses you have placed in Germany?

This is the most powerful verification question. Legitimate agencies are proud of their placed nurses and will connect you directly. Fraudulent agencies will give you fake testimonials, uncontactable phone numbers, or social media screenshots that could be fabricated. Speak to real nurses. Ask them what their experience was.

6 Have any of your candidates had their visa rejected or their Germany process fail?

An honest agency will acknowledge that this happens sometimes โ€” due to document issues, employer changes, or candidate circumstances. An agency that claims a 100% success rate with zero failures is either lying or has placed very few people.

Questions About the Financial Model

7 What exactly will I be paying, and what is it for?

Get a complete, itemised breakdown of every rupee you will pay โ€” when, for what, and what happens if the placement does not happen. Vague answers are red flags.

8 Do you charge a placement or recruitment fee to candidates?

Under fair recruitment principles โ€” which Germany's recruitment framework is built on โ€” placement fees should be paid by the employer, not the candidate. Any agency charging you a non-refundable placement or processing fee upfront should be scrutinised carefully.

9 Is any part of what I pay refundable? Under what conditions?

10 Who pays you โ€” the candidate or the German employer?

A legitimate agency earns primarily from employer placement fees. If an agency's business model is heavily dependent on candidate fees โ€” large upfront payments from nurses โ€” it is a serious red flag. Their incentive should be your placement, not your payment.

Questions About Language Training

11 Where does the German language training happen and who teaches it?

Ask for the names and qualifications of the trainers. Ask to visit the classroom. Ask how many batches are currently running. A legitimate training organisation has real infrastructure and real people. Fraudulent agencies will give you vague answers about "partner institutes" or "online platforms."

12 What is your B2 pass rate?

A serious training organisation tracks this number. Ask for it specifically. If they cannot tell you what percentage of their candidates pass the TELC B2 exam, they either do not track it or the number is not favourable.

13 How do you handle candidates who fail B2 or struggle with the language?

The answer tells you a great deal about the organisation's culture. Legitimate agencies support struggling candidates โ€” additional classes, one-on-one sessions, rescheduled exams. Fraudulent agencies lose interest in candidates who are not progressing because they have already collected their fees.

Questions About the Placement Process

14 Which German or Austrian employers do you currently have active relationships with?

Ask for specific names โ€” not categories like "various hospitals." A serious placement organisation has named, verifiable employer relationships. You do not need a complete confidential client list โ€” but the agency should be able to name at least some of their employer partners.

15 How is the employer matching done โ€” what criteria do you use?

Good matching considers: the candidate's clinical specialisation, the employer's department needs, location preference, and language level. Generic "we match everyone" answers are less reassuring than specific matching criteria.

16 How long does it typically take from B2 clearance to job offer?

The honest answer is usually 4โ€“12 weeks, depending on employer availability and document readiness. Agencies that promise job offers within days of B2 clearance are likely overselling.

Questions About the Process

17 Who guides me through the Berufsanerkennung (qualification recognition) process?

This is one of the most complex parts of the Germany journey. Ask who specifically handles this guidance โ€” is it an in-house team, or is it outsourced? What happens if the recognition authority requests additional documents?

18 What support do you provide after I arrive in Germany?

Legitimate agencies do not disappear after you board the flight. Ask about post-arrival support โ€” Anmeldung guidance, settling-in help, what to do if there are problems with the employer.

19 What happens if my employer withdraws the offer after I arrive?

This is rare but it happens. A legitimate agency has a plan โ€” alternative employer matching, a support period. An agency with no answer to this question has not thought beyond collecting its fee.

20 Can I visit your office and meet your trainers before enrolling?

This is the simplest and most revealing question of all. A legitimate organisation will say yes immediately. A fraudulent one will make excuses, suggest a video call instead, or become evasive. If you cannot visit their physical office and meet their team in person โ€” do not enrol.
